收藏
回答

调用微信登陆授权时,出现Uninitialized ActivityThread问题?

查看论坛已经有很多人提出这个问题了,但却没有一个官方正统回复。都是让人上传日志。

说说我遇到的问题吧,在Unity制作的游戏中接入微信登陆。之前正常,最近因为接入其他SDK,引入了android.support-v7 28.

重新打包组件以后,点击微信授权出现此错误,并且程序崩溃。

11-12 15:55:38.870  4944  4944 E Instrumentation: Uninitialized ActivityThread, likely app-created Instrumentation, disabling AppComponentFactory11-12 15:55:38.870  4944  4944 E Instrumentation: java.lang.Throwable

11-12 15:55:38.870  4944  4944 E Instrumentation: at android.app.Instrumentation.getFactory(Instrumentation.java:1273)

11-12 15:55:38.870  4944  4944 E Instrumentation: at android.app.Instrumentation.newActivity(Instrumentation.java:1264)

11-12 15:55:38.870  4944  4944 E Instrumentation: at com.tencent.mm.splash.k.newActivity(SourceFile:61)

11-12 15:55:38.870  4944  4944 E Instrumentation: at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:3798)

11-12 15:55:38.870  4944  4944 E Instrumentation: at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:4074)

11-12 15:55:38.870  4944  4944 E Instrumentation: at android.app.servertransaction.LaunchActivityItem.execute(LaunchActivityItem.java:91)

11-12 15:55:38.870  4944  4944 E Instrumentation: at android.app.servertransaction.TransactionExecutor.executeCallbacks(TransactionExecutor.java:149)

11-12 15:55:38.870  4944  4944 E Instrumentation: at android.app.servertransaction.TransactionExecutor.execute(TransactionExecutor.java:103)

11-12 15:55:38.870  4944  4944 E Instrumentation: at android.app.ActivityThread$H.handleMessage(ActivityThread.java:2473)

11-12 15:55:38.870  4944  4944 E Instrumentation: at android.os.Handler.dispatchMessage(Handler.java:110)

11-12 15:55:38.870  4944  4944 E Instrumentation: at android.os.Looper.loop(Looper.java:219)

11-12 15:55:38.870  4944  4944 E Instrumentation: at android.app.ActivityThread.main(ActivityThread.java:8347)

11-12 15:55:38.870  4944  4944 E Instrumentation: at java.lang.reflect.Method.invoke(Native Method)

11-12 15:55:38.870  4944  4944 E Instrumentation: at com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:513)

11-12 15:55:38.870  4944  4944 E Instrumentation: at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:1055)

看了论坛,很多人遇到同样的问题,连报错的文件行都一样:

com.tencent.mm.splash.k.newActivity(SourceFile:61)

我使用的SDK是wechat-sdk-android-with-mta-5.1.4,android环境。出现的情况是:调用微信授权后,顺利进入微信页面,但是出现正在登陆的选项后,直接报错。

回答关注问题邀请回答
收藏

1 个回答

  • 小游戏运营专员-宏
    小游戏运营专员-宏
    11-13

    你好,麻烦在手机微信那里上传下日志: 我->设置->帮助与反馈右上角有个上报日志的入口,麻烦提供一下微信号,时间点

    11-13
    有用
    回复 2
    • 微帮
      微帮
      11-16
      刚刚已经上传了日志,微信号是:wxid_9yajmmhnk1se22
      11-16
      回复
    • 微帮
      微帮
      11-16
      故障发生在连接一个路由器的wifi上,所以安卓手机都会出现这个问题,当切换其他路由器或者切换到4G网络的情况下,问题消失
      11-16
      回复
登录 后发表内容
问题标签